What you’ll do

Become part of an iconic brand that is set to revolutionize the electric pick-up truck & rugged SUV marketplace by achieving the following:

  • Design and Development: Engineer steering system components; including Electric Power Steering (EPS), steering columns, and intermediate shafts. Lead the design and development processes for these components.
  • Supplier Coordination: Interface with suppliers to ensure components meet structural, performance, and packaging requirements.
  • Chassis and Drive Systems Integration: Contribute to the development and integration of chassis and drive systems for Scout all-electric pick-up trucks and rugged SUVs.
  • Technical Excellence: Uphold the vision of engineering excellence and serve as a source of technical knowledge. Introduce innovative ideas and collaborate cross-functionally to achieve the Scout vision.
  • Engineering Improvements: Critically review existing designs, ideas, and specifications, proposing engineering improvements.
  • Team Collaboration: Collaborate with team members to design and develop improved packaging and testing strategies, fostering engagement and contributions from all involved.
  • Solution Development: Partner with concept and systems architecture teams to develop solutions for engineering and functional challenges.
  • Prototype and Serial Development: Coordinate prototype and serial development stages, including part availability, test planning, and part releases.

What you’ll bring 

We expect all Scout employees to have integrity, curiosity, resourcefulness, and strive to exhibit a positive attitude, as well as a growth mindset. You’ll be comfortable with change and flexible in a fast-paced, high-growth environment. You’ll take a collaborative approach to achieve ambitious goals. Here's what else you'll bring: 

  • Educational Background: Bachelor’s or master’s degree in Engineering, Technology, or Engineering Technology.
  • Experience: 4+ years of EPS (electric power steering) experience in concept engineering or serial development, with a focus on platforms/variants, module selection, and modification within the chassis environment.
  • Technical Skills: Proficiency in CAD/FEA part design, testing, and development engineering related to steering systems. Experience with requirements management, system integration, and manufacturing and assembly processes.
  • Project Management: Advanced project steering and coordination skills, with the ability to independently manage projects within a defined chassis part scope.
  • Motivation and Innovation: Highly motivated engineer eager to work at the forefront of electric vehicle technical design, generate innovative ideas and solutions, and engage in hands-on testing.
  • Interpersonal Skills: Strong interpersonal skills, including ownership, self-motivation, problem-solving, analytical thinking, teamwork, innovation, creativity
